Comprehending ADHD in Adults

ADHD is characterized by consistent patterns of inattention and/or hyperactivity-impulsivity that hinder functioning or development. In adults, signs might manifest in a different way than in kids, causing obstacles in different aspects of life. Below is a table summing up typical signs of ADHD in adults.

Symptoms of ADHD in AdultsDescription
InattentionProblem focusing, forgetfulness, poor organization, and distractibility.
HyperactivityExtreme talking, restlessness, and a constant sense of being "on the go."
ImpulsivityProblem waiting in lines, disrupting others, and making rash decisions.
Psychological DysregulationState of mind swings, aggravation tolerance, and trouble managing tension.
Low MotivationObstacles in setting and attaining personal goals.

Diagnosis and Assessment

Getting a correct medical diagnosis is important for grownups who believe they have ADHD. A thorough evaluation generally includes:

  1. Clinical Interview: A psychological health expert gathers info about the individual's history, signs, and functional problems.
  2. Self-Reported Questionnaires: Standardized tools such as the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) may be utilized.
  3. Behavioral Assessments: Input from family, friends, or associates can supply important insight into the individual's functioning.

Treatment Options

While there is no conclusive "cure" for ADHD, many reliable treatments can help handle symptoms and enhance quality of life. Treatment can include medication, treatment, and way of life changes. Here's a breakdown of common techniques:

Treatment OptionsDescription
MedicationStimulant medications (like Adderall) and non-stimulant options (like Strattera) can assist enhance focus and minimize impulsivity.
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)CBT works in assisting adults with ADHD establish coping methods and restructure negative thought patterns.
CoachingADHD coaches can assist people with company, time management, and goal-setting.
Support GroupsGetting in touch with others who share similar experiences can provide emotional support and practical advice.
Way of life ChangesRoutine workout, a healthy diet plan, appropriate sleep, and mindfulness practices such as meditation can significantly benefit ADHD symptoms.

Way Of Life Modifications to Consider

For many grownups, embracing particular way of life modifications can assist manage ADHD symptoms efficiently. Here are some suggestions:

  1. Establish Routines: Develop an everyday schedule to promote consistency and decrease lapse of memory.
  2. Set Clear Goals: Break larger tasks into smaller, manageable steps and set deadlines to help keep focus and motivation.
  3. Lessen Distractions: Create a devoted work area and lower ecological diversions to boost concentration.
  4. Practice Mindfulness: Engage in mindfulness practices, such as meditation or yoga, to enhance focus and decrease stress.
  5. Exercise Regularly: Physical activity can help in reducing hyperactivity and improve state of mind, promoting overall wellness.
